The Importance of Support Systems in Alternative Insemination: Building a Strong Network

The journey to starting a family through alternative insemination can be an emotional and challenging one. Whether you are a single parent or a couple, having a strong support system in place can make all the difference. In this blog post, we will explore the importance of support systems in alternative insemination and how building a strong network can lead to a more positive and successful experience.

First and foremost, support systems provide emotional support during a time that can be filled with uncertainty and anxiety. The decision to pursue alternative insemination can be a difficult one, and having a network of friends, family, or even online support groups can offer a sense of comfort and understanding. These individuals can provide a safe space to share thoughts and feelings, and offer encouragement and positivity during the journey.

Support systems also offer practical support, especially for those who are single parents or part of a same-sex couple. This may include help with childcare, transportation to appointments, or even financial assistance. Building a network of individuals who are willing to lend a helping hand can make the process of alternative insemination more manageable and less overwhelming.

In addition to emotional and practical support, support systems can also provide valuable knowledge and resources. This is especially important for those who are new to alternative insemination and may have questions or concerns. Having a network of individuals who have gone through the process themselves or have extensive knowledge on the subject can be incredibly beneficial. They can offer advice, share their experiences, and provide recommendations for healthcare providers or sperm banks.

Another important aspect of support systems in alternative insemination is the sense of community they provide. Many individuals and couples going through this process may feel isolated or like they are the only ones facing these challenges. However, by connecting with others who are also on this journey, they can find a sense of belonging and camaraderie. This can be particularly helpful for those who may not have a strong support system within their own families or communities.

It’s also worth noting that support systems can extend past just emotional and practical support. They can also offer a sense of accountability and motivation. When a person or couple has a strong network of individuals who believe in their journey, it can serve as a driving force to keep pushing forward. This can be especially helpful during the ups and downs of the alternative insemination process.

Building a strong support system may seem like a daunting task, especially for those who may not have a large network of friends or family. However, it’s important to remember that support can come from many different places. Online communities, support groups, and even healthcare providers can all serve as valuable sources of support. It’s also important to reach out to friends and family, even if they may not fully understand the alternative insemination process. They can still offer emotional support and be there for you during this journey.

In addition, it’s crucial to communicate openly and honestly with your support system. This includes expressing your needs and boundaries, as well as being open to receiving help and advice. By having clear and open communication, you can build a strong foundation for your support system and ensure that they are able to provide the best support possible.
